Fault Light Flashing
DRYFT has been designed to be easily serviceable and simple to repair by the end-user. In the unlikely event of a component failure please navigate the Fault Warning Lights section below to solve your issue.
Please select the appropriate option:
-

Brush Fault - Check Connection
Most likely a broken motor cable or lock detected (brush fault led), possible PCB fault.
-

Solenoid Undercurrent
Undercurrent detected on solenoid pod. Check cables, connections and motor.
-

Solenoid Overcurrent
Overcurrent detected on solenoid pod. Check cables, connections and motor.
-

Suction Undercurrent
Undercurrent detected on suction pod. Check cables, connections and motor.
-

Suction Overcurrent
Overcurrent detected on suction pod. Check cables, connections and motor.
-

PCB Fault 0x001
PCB is likely faulty.
-

PCB Fault 0x002
PCB is faulty.
-

PCB Fault 0x003
PCB is faulty. Also check battery and connections.
